Helldivers 2: The Delta Zone
Get ready to deploy into the heart of the action with Helldivers 2: The Delta Zone. This frantic cooperative shooter throws you and your squad against a relentless alien invasion. Fight side-by-side with your comrades in a variety of desolate landscapes, utilizing devastating weaponry and tactical maneuvers to achieve victory. With a focus on teamw